Searched defs:capabilities (Results 1 - 13 of 13) sorted by relevance

/system/core/libcutils/include/private/
H A Dfs_config.h33 uint64_t capabilities; member in struct:fs_path_config_from_file
H A Dandroid_filesystem_config.h145 * They indicate special Android capabilities that the kernel is aware of. */
200 uint64_t capabilities; member in struct:fs_path_config
219 unsigned* mode, uint64_t* capabilities);
/system/core/libcutils/include_vndk/private/
H A Dfs_config.h33 uint64_t capabilities; member in struct:fs_path_config_from_file
H A Dandroid_filesystem_config.h145 * They indicate special Android capabilities that the kernel is aware of. */
200 uint64_t capabilities; member in struct:fs_path_config
219 unsigned* mode, uint64_t* capabilities);
/system/extras/ext4_utils/
H A Dcontents.h35 uint64_t capabilities; member in struct:dentry
44 int inode_set_capabilities(u32 inode_num, uint64_t capabilities);
H A Dcontents.c477 int inode_set_capabilities(u32 inode_num, uint64_t capabilities) { argument
478 if (capabilities == 0)
485 cap_data.data[0].permitted = (uint32_t) (capabilities & 0xffffffff);
487 cap_data.data[1].permitted = (uint32_t) (capabilities >> 32);
H A Dmake_ext4fs.c222 uint64_t capabilities; local
229 fs_config_func(dentries[i].path, dir, target_out_path, &uid, &gid, &mode, &capabilities);
233 dentries[i].capabilities = capabilities;
341 ret = inode_set_capabilities(entry_inode, dentries[i].capabilities);
/system/core/libcutils/
H A Dcanned_fs_config.c32 uint64_t capabilities; member in struct:__anon1517
66 p->capabilities = 0;
70 if (token && strncmp(token, "capabilities=", 13) == 0) {
71 p->capabilities = strtoll(token+13, NULL, 0);
90 unsigned* uid, unsigned* gid, unsigned* mode, uint64_t* capabilities) {
103 *capabilities = p->capabilities;
116 if (c_capabilities != *capabilities) {
117 printf("%s capabilities %" PRIx64 " %" PRIx64 "\n",
119 *capabilities,
89 canned_fs_config(const char* path, int dir, const char* target_out_path, unsigned* uid, unsigned* gid, unsigned* mode, uint64_t* capabilities) argument
[all...]
H A Dfs_config.c182 /* the following files have enhanced capabilities and ARE included
297 unsigned* mode, uint64_t* capabilities) {
343 *capabilities = get8LE((const uint8_t*)&(header.capabilities));
359 *capabilities = pc->capabilities;
375 p->capabilities = get8LE((const uint8_t*)&(pc->capabilities));
296 fs_config(const char* path, int dir, const char* target_out_path, unsigned* uid, unsigned* gid, unsigned* mode, uint64_t* capabilities) argument
/system/core/adb/
H A Dfile_sync_service.cpp57 static bool update_capabilities(const char* path, uint64_t capabilities) { argument
58 if (capabilities == 0) {
59 // Ensure we clean up in case the capabilities weren't 0 in the past.
66 cap_data.data[0].permitted = (capabilities & 0xffffffff);
68 cap_data.data[1].permitted = (capabilities >> 32);
77 uint64_t capabilities = 0; local
88 fs_config(partial_path.c_str(), 1, nullptr, &uid, &gid, &mode, &capabilities);
100 if (!update_capabilities(partial_path.c_str(), capabilities)) return false;
201 static bool handle_send_file(int s, const char* path, uid_t uid, gid_t gid, uint64_t capabilities, argument
264 if (!update_capabilities(path, capabilities)) {
398 uint64_t capabilities = 0; local
[all...]
/system/core/cpio/
H A Dmkbootfs.c61 uint64_t capabilities; local
86 fs_config(path, is_dir, target_out_path, &s->st_uid, &s->st_gid, &st_mode, &capabilities);
/system/core/include/private/
H A Dandroid_filesystem_config.h145 * They indicate special Android capabilities that the kernel is aware of. */
200 uint64_t capabilities; member in struct:fs_path_config
219 unsigned* mode, uint64_t* capabilities);
/system/core/init/
H A Dservice.cpp173 const std::vector<gid_t>& supp_gids, const CapSet& capabilities,
184 capabilities_(capabilities),
266 LOG(FATAL) << "cannot set capabilities for " << name_;
335 *err = "capabilities requested but the kernel does not support ambient capabilities";
546 {"capabilities",
172 Service(const std::string& name, unsigned flags, uid_t uid, gid_t gid, const std::vector<gid_t>& supp_gids, const CapSet& capabilities, unsigned namespace_flags, const std::string& seclabel, const std::vector<std::string>& args) argument

Completed in 781 milliseconds